Just as Jiang Cheng was drinking porridge and eating fried dough sticks, a man in a shirt sat next to Jiang Cheng. He looked quite young, probably less than 30 years old.
"Master, you just said that you wanted to get cloth coupons to buy a mosquito net, right?" asked the man in the shirt.
"Yes, there is a problem." Jiang Cheng soaked the fried dough sticks in the porridge, took it up and took a bite and replied.
"Can I ask if you want a single or a double?"
"It's all right."
"Then if I give you a mosquito net ticket, how much fish can you give me?"
After hearing what the shirt man said, Jiang Cheng finally understood that the other party must have mosquito net tickets. These mosquito net tickets are not easy to get, and it should be said that they are not easier to get than cloth tickets. At least many people have cloth tickets, but the quantity is small, but there are not many people who have mosquito net tickets. You can't get them unless you have a good unit or a good job.
The fact that mosquito net coupons are hard to get does not mean that they are expensive. After all, cloth coupons can be used to buy mosquito nets and all products containing cloth.
Mosquito net tickets can only be used to purchase mosquito nets. Otherwise, if the mosquito nets are not used, the most you can do is light mosquito coils to keep the house warm. However, cloth is an indispensable thing in life.
Jiang Cheng originally thought that if he couldn't exchange for cloth coupons, he would have to deal with the fish. Since the man in front of him had mosquito net coupons, he could give them all to him. Moreover, Jiang Cheng felt that the other party wanted a lot of fish, and not just for himself.
After talking for a while, it was decided that the mosquito net ticket was only a condition for the other party to buy the fish. The fish was still sold at the market price of 40 cents, and if it was not higher than the market price, it would be considered as a mosquito net ticket.
The man in the shirt didn't have the mosquito net ticket on him, so he asked Jiang Cheng to wait at the breakfast shop. He would be back in ten minutes at most.
There is no problem in waiting for ten minutes or so. Jiang Cheng has to savor the fried dough sticks carefully.
Jiang Cheng found that the dough sticks of this era were harder and not as crispy as those of later generations. But the weight was different in the hand, and it felt a bit thicker, which also made it taste different.
In later times, fried dough sticks can be very large and hollow, but the fried dough sticks that Jiang Cheng bought here are not small, but not very hollow inside. When bitten open, there are many big holes inside.
At least a lot of flour is used in this dish. They charge you two taels of food coupons for one fried dough stick. Even if it is not two taels of flour, it must be at least one tael more.
Anyway, the fried dough sticks of this era have their own merits compared to those of later generations, but at least there are no additives in this era, and after eating the fried dough sticks, there is a wheat flour aroma in your mouth.
Jiang Cheng only ate two fried dough sticks. He planned to save the rest for later and bring them back for his wife and his parents who were coming to the city to try.
For the unfinished fried dough sticks, this breakfast shop has special oil paper for wrapping buns and fried dough sticks. Jiang Cheng wrapped one end with the oil paper and put it in the net bag.
Not long after the fried dough sticks were packed, the man in the shirt who wanted to trade with Jiang Cheng came, ran up to Jiang Cheng and gave him a ticket.
Jiang Cheng took a look and saw the words "issued by Yuxincheng Commercial Bureau" on the ticket, and in the middle it was written "single mosquito net and one bed". To be honest, Jiang Cheng had always thought that the unit of measurement for mosquito nets was "sheets", just like fishing nets. After looking at the ticket in his hand, he realized that mosquito nets were measured in "beds".
"Comrade, are you from the Commercial Bureau?" Jiang Cheng couldn't help but ask while looking at the ticket.
"Yes, the weather is hot, so I came to buy some breakfast and took it back without my work clothes." The man in the shirt said with a smile.
After confirming his guess, Jiang Cheng felt a little embarrassed. He felt that he had run into trouble. Nowadays, speculation and profiteering are under the jurisdiction of the Commercial Bureau.
Jiang Cheng sold things to the people in the Commerce Bureau, and felt a bit like being stung. "Master, there is no scale here, how about you take these fish to the vegetable market in front and weigh them." The man from the Commerce Bureau said to Jiang Cheng.
"No problem, this is my first time here, please take me there." Jiang Cheng replied.
After reaching a consensus, Jiang Cheng and the other party carried the sacks and headed towards the vegetable market together, and they naturally chatted politely along the way.
During this casual chat, Jiang Cheng learned the other person's name, Wei Sheng.
What I didn’t expect was that the other party was actually a deputy section chief, and their Commercial Bureau was indeed responsible for that kind of speculative matters.
But Jiang Cheng said that the fish was given to him by his employer because he was doing a favor for him. Speculation is about buying low and selling high. Jiang Cheng did not deliberately make a profit from the price difference, so it was not speculation.
It's just like someone fishing by the river and selling the fish to others. It doesn't count as reselling.
In addition to regulating reselling, the Commerce Bureau is also responsible for managing and supervising various industries. For example, when a waiter in a restaurant beats up a customer, the sign in the restaurant that says "Do not beat up customers at will" was put up by someone from the Commerce Bureau.
Don't underestimate the people in the Commercial Bureau because they seem to be powerful and have many things to do. But this is not an easy job, and it can even be said to be an offensive job.
The most direct point is that people from other units can secretly go to the Pigeon Market to buy things. If they are caught, they will generally be educated, and in serious cases, the unit will be notified.
But the staff of the Commerce Bureau must set an example by not going to the Pigeon Market to buy things, because they are responsible for this. When managing some units, you must also be upright.
Anyway, as long as the leader of the Commerce Bureau is not crooked, the Commerce Bureau in this era is a poor office.
I weighed the fish at the fair scale in the vegetable market. It was over 43 pounds, and cost 17.20 yuan.
More than 40 kilograms of fish, why would someone give so much for doing such a favor? Seventeen dollars and twenty cents, some workers don't even get that much in half a month's wages. I think Jiang Cheng bought the fish at a low price, but Wei Sheng didn't say anything because it would be useless.
It is the industry norm for drivers to bring goods. If this is the case, and he, a deputy section chief, challenges the industry norm, I guarantee that Jiang Cheng will be criticized by the company at most, but his tenure as deputy section chief will definitely end.
Don’t think that Yuxin is separated from Changcheng by several cities. Catching drivers carrying goods is not targeting individuals, but a challenge to a profession.
As long as this is done, Wei Sheng will have to give an explanation if he is not dealt with. Yuxin Commercial Bureau will not have a good life in the future, and Yuxin Bus Station will have to find a way to cause trouble for the other party.
In addition, workers in this era all have unions, and if they violate industry rules, even if these industry rules are not acceptable, the drivers in the union will stand up for Jiang Cheng.
So Jiang Cheng and Wei Sheng had a pleasant exchange, and even Wei Sheng began to hint to Jiang Cheng that if he had any goods in the future and passed by Yu Xincheng, he should come to him. Their unit didn't have much food and drink, but there were a lot of miscellaneous tickets.
Jiang Cheng also readily agreed. He mainly travels long distances. Every month, he occasionally travels to nearby cities for a while, so that he has time to go home frequently.
It would be nice to come here to buy something when you are on a short trip. The two of them separated after returning to the breakfast shop. Wei Sheng wanted to take the fish back and then go to work.
Jiang Cheng had no control over how Wei Sheng dealt with the fish. He also had to go to the warehouse of the transport station to take a look.
